深入解析VPN 412错误,原因、诊断与解决方案
在现代网络环境中,虚拟私人网络(VPN)已成为企业远程办公、个人隐私保护和跨境访问的重要工具,用户在使用过程中常常遇到各种连接问题,412错误”尤为常见,本文将从网络工程师的专业角度出发,深入剖析VPN 412错误的成因、排查方法及可行的解决方案,帮助用户快速恢复稳定连接。
什么是VPN 412错误?
该错误通常出现在使用PPTP(点对点隧道协议)或某些定制化SSL-VPN客户端时,系统返回的状态码“412”表示“Precondition Failed”(前提条件失败),这表明服务器无法满足客户端发起请求所需的先决条件,可能是配置错误、认证失败、网络策略限制或服务端异常所致。
常见的触发场景包括:
- 身份验证失败:用户输入的用户名或密码错误,或者证书过期;
- 协议不匹配:客户端与服务器支持的加密算法或协议版本不一致(如客户端使用PPTP而服务器仅启用L2TP/IPSec);
- 防火墙/安全策略拦截:企业级防火墙阻止了特定端口(如PPTP使用的TCP 1723),或NAT设备未正确转发;
- 服务器负载过高或宕机:当大量用户同时接入,服务器资源不足导致响应超时;
- 本地网络环境干扰:如路由器固件缺陷、DNS污染或ISP劫持等。
作为网络工程师,在处理此类问题时应遵循以下步骤:
第一步:确认错误日志
查看客户端日志(如Windows事件查看器中的“远程桌面连接”或第三方VPN客户端日志),定位具体报错内容,若显示“Authentication failed”则优先检查账号密码;若出现“Connection timeout”,则需排查网络连通性。
第二步:测试基础连通性
使用ping和tracert命令检测到目标VPN服务器的路径是否通畅,若发现丢包或延迟高,可尝试更换DNS(如改为8.8.8.8)或联系ISP确认是否存在QoS限速。
第三步:检查协议与端口
确保客户端配置与服务器设置一致,若服务器要求使用OpenVPN协议,则必须在客户端安装对应配置文件并开启UDP 1194端口,必要时可通过telnet测试端口开放状态:telnet <server_ip> 1723(PPTP)或telnet <server_ip> 1194(OpenVPN)。
第四步:审查防火墙与NAT规则
在路由器或防火墙上添加放行规则,允许相关协议通过,对于企业环境,还需检查是否有ACL(访问控制列表)误封了内网IP段。
第五步:升级软件与补丁
老旧的客户端或服务器软件可能存在已知漏洞,建议更新至最新版本,并启用更强的加密算法(如AES-256而非DES)以增强安全性。
如果上述步骤无效,可考虑临时切换至其他协议(如从PPTP切换为WireGuard),或联系服务商获取技术支持,一个稳定的VPN连接不仅依赖于技术配置,更需要良好的网络基础设施和持续维护。
面对VPN 412错误,耐心排查、逐层定位是关键,作为一名合格的网络工程师,不仅要懂原理,更要具备实战经验,才能高效解决用户痛点,保障数据安全与业务连续性。

半仙加速器-海外加速器|VPN加速器|vpn翻墙加速器|VPN梯子|VPN外网加速
@版权声明
转载原创文章请注明转载自半仙加速器-海外加速器|VPN加速器|vpn翻墙加速器|VPN梯子|VPN外网加速,网站地址:https://www.web-banxianjiasuqi.com/